The Town Parks, Recreation and Tourism (PR&T) Department stands as a vibrant hub dedicated to enhancing community life by offering diverse recreational, wellness, and tourism programs. As a municipal department, it is committed to promoting healthy lifestyles, fostering community engagement, and creating meaningful experiences for residents of all ages. Serving a broad demographic, the department coordinates numerous programs ranging from athletics and summer camps to wellness classes and special events, ensuring that the recreational needs and interests of the town’s population are met with professionalism and enthusiasm.

Job Duties
- Plan, organize, and promote recreation programs including athletics, summer camps, and wellness classes
- perform administrative tasks such as typing, copying, and updating files
- recruit, train, assign, and supervise volunteers
- maintain records of staff and volunteer hours and report to the supervisor
- evaluate program effectiveness and recruit additional instructors
- prepare and administer contracts for vendors and instructors
- supervise recreation staff including scheduling and training
- solicit private contributions
- provide assistance across all divisions
- coordinate and verify activity schedules
- greet participants and enforce facility policies
- handle minor first-aid incidents and prepare accident reports
- drive activity bus as needed
- maintain a clean work environment
- promote programs on social media and website
- create marketing flyers and plans
